Wisconsin Bioenergy Summit
Started in 2008, the Wisconsin Bioenergy Initiative (WBI) holds an annual Bioenergy Summit in the fall that is free and open to the public. Biofuel leaders and stakeholders gather to listen to key speakers and engage in plenary sessions, interactive breakout sessions and workshops all focusing on bioenergy and biofuels. Content includes subjects such as biomass conversion and sustainablity, bioenergy incentives and economics, and bioenergy education.
